A,C,F,G,J,L,N,O,P,R,T,U,VCardinal Hume ® (Shrub, Harkness 1982) [HARregale]

Shrub.  Violet-red.  Strong, cinnamon, fruity fragrance.  Small, full (26-40 petals), cluster-flowered, in small clusters bloom form.  Blooms in flushes throughout the season.  USDA zone 5b through 10b.  Height of 30" to 6' (75 to 185 cm).  Width of 35" to 8' (90 to 245 cm). Harkness & Co. (1982).
